To find the expected value of the amount the insurance company must pay, we can use the formula for expected value:

E(X) = ∑ (r * P(X = r))

Substituting the pmf and the calculated value of c:

E(X) = ∑ (r * 0.2443 * 0.9^(r-1)), for r = 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6

E(X) = (1 * 0.2443 * 0.9^0) + (2 * 0.2443 * 0.9^1) + (3 * 0.2443 * 0.9^2) + (4 * 0.2443 * 0.9^3) + (5 * 0.2443 * 0.9^4) + (6 * 0.2443 * 0.9^5)

E(X) ≈ 0.2443 + 0.4398 + 0.5905 + 0.5905 + 0.5314 + 0.4783

E(X) ≈ 2.8748

use the limit definition to find the slope of the tangent line to the graph of f at the given point. f(x) = 14 − x2, (3, 5)

Answers

Use the limit definition to find the slope of the tangent line to the graph of f at the given point. f(x) = 14 − x2, (3, 5)

The slope of the tangent line to the graph of f at (3, 5) is -6.

The slope of the tangent line to the graph of f at (3, 5) can be found using the limit definition of the slope. The slope of the tangent line can be calculated as the limit of the average rate of change of the function f(x) between two points as the distance between the points approaches zero. The formula is given by: lim _(h → 0) [f(x + h) - f(x)] / h

where h is the change in x, which is the difference between the x-value of the point in question and the x-value of another point on the tangent line. The given function is f(x) = 14 - x². To find the slope of the tangent line at x = 3, we need to calculate the limit of the average rate of change of f(x) as x approaches 3.

Using the formula,

lim_(h → 0) [f(x + h) - f(x)] / h

= lim_(h → 0) [(14 - (x + h)²) - (14 - x²)] / h

= lim_(h → 0) [14 - x² - 2xh - h² - 14 + x²] / h

= lim_(h → 0) [-2xh - h²] / h

= lim_(h → 0) [-h(2x + h)] / h

= lim_(h → 0) [-2x - h] = -2x

When x = 3, the slope of the tangent line is -2(3) = -6.

Therefore, the slope of the tangent line to the graph of f at (3, 5) is -6.
